Key Features
Optosky Micro Spectrometer (ATP2000 Series)
- Maximum spectral range: 190nm - 1100nm (up to 800nm wide)
- Signal acquisition frame rate: Up to 4Kfps
- Detector: Linear low-noise CMOS
- Detector pixels: 2048 or 4096 pixels
- Spectral resolution: 0.1 to 3.0 nm (depending on spectral range and slit width)
- Optical path structure: Cross C-T
- Integration time: 0.2ms to 65s
- Power supply: DC 5V ±5% or USB power
- ADC: 16bit, 15MSPS
- Fiber input interface: SMA905 or free-space input
- Data output interfaces: USB 2.0, UART, or Gigabit Ethernet
- 20-pin dual-row programmable expansion interface
Key Features
High Power VIS-IR Light Source (ATG1100)
- Broad spectrum:360~2500nm
- Built-in 100W Halogen lamp
- Constant current high blue spectrum output
- High-efficiency and low-loss optical coupling
- Long lifetime>2000hrs
- High stability, spectral shift ≤0.5% per hour
- Adjustable output light intensity
- Good heat dissipation performance to ensure continuous and stable power output
Specifications
High Power VIS-IR Light Source (ATG1100)
- Built-in light source: 100W spectrum Halogen Lamp
- Colour temperature: 5000k
- Drift of optical output: <0.5% per="">0.5%>
- Light source life: >2000 hours
- Llight source output: SMA905 optical fiber interface
- Maximum output optical power: 6.3W
Remarks
- Users should have optical background to operate optical instruments.
- The instruments are desktop equipment and come with DC power supply sources.
- Software should be installed on a computer to interface with the instruments.
- All optical instruments should be kept clean and handled properly.
- For safety reasons, users are advised not to look directly at the output of the light source or the optical fiber connectors.
